The MSComm control is a bit more basic than what I think you are looking for. You could certainly use the msComm control to connect two PCs together, but you would have to write all of the protocols. The comm control is really more for developing applications to interface with hardware connected to the com port. Having said this, you could certainly write all of the code to handle interfacing two computers through a comm port, but it would be far easier to simply buy two network cards and allow Windows to do what it was designed to do.
